FAQs About Chino Park
Are there facilities or amenities for walkers/runners in Chino Park in Hoffman Estates?
Yes, Chino Park in Hoffman Estates offers a parking lot, making it convenient for walkers and runners to access the park and start their activities.
How accessible is Chino Park in Hoffman Estates?
Chino Park in Hoffman Estates is easily accessible with its parking lot and well-maintained pathways, providing a comfortable environment for walking, running, and other sports activities.
What kind of sports can I do in Chino Park in Hoffman Estates?
Chino Park in Hoffman Estates provides sports facilities such as a baseball court, offering opportunities for individuals to engage in baseball and other related sports activities.
